- package database
- import (
- "database/sql"
- "encoding/json"
- "sync"
- log "maunium.net/go/maulogger/v2"
- "maunium.net/go/mautrix/appservice"
- "maunium.net/go/mautrix/event"
- "maunium.net/go/mautrix/id"
- )
- type SQLStateStore struct {
- *appservice.TypingStateStore
- db *Database
- log log.Logger
- Typing map[id.RoomID]map[id.UserID]int64
- typingLock sync.RWMutex
- }
- // make sure that SQLStateStore implements the appservice.StateStore interface
- var _ appservice.StateStore = (*SQLStateStore)(nil)
- func NewSQLStateStore(db *Database) *SQLStateStore {
- return &SQLStateStore{
- TypingStateStore: appservice.NewTypingStateStore(),
- db: db,
- log: db.log.Sub("StateStore"),
- }
- }
- func (s *SQLStateStore) IsRegistered(userID id.UserID) bool {
- var isRegistered bool
- query := "SELECT EXISTS(SELECT 1 FROM mx_registrations WHERE user_id=$1)"
- row := s.db.QueryRow(query, userID)
- err := row.Scan(&isRegistered)
- if err != nil {
- s.log.Warnfln("Failed to scan registration existence for %s: %v", userID, err)
- }
- return isRegistered
- }
- func (s *SQLStateStore) MarkRegistered(userID id.UserID) {
- query := "INSERT INTO mx_registrations (user_id) VALUES ($1)" +
- " ON CONFLICT (user_id) DO NOTHING"
- _, err := s.db.Exec(query, userID)
- if err != nil {
- s.log.Warnfln("Failed to mark %s as registered: %v", userID, err)
- }
- }
- func (s *SQLStateStore) IsTyping(roomID id.RoomID, userID id.UserID) bool {
- s.log.Debugln("IsTyping")
- return false
- }
- func (s *SQLStateStore) SetTyping(roomID id.RoomID, userID id.UserID, timeout int64) {
- s.log.Debugln("SetTyping")
- }
- func (s *SQLStateStore) IsInRoom(roomID id.RoomID, userID id.UserID) bool {
- return s.IsMembership(roomID, userID, "join")
- }
- func (s *SQLStateStore) IsInvited(roomID id.RoomID, userID id.UserID) bool {
- return s.IsMembership(roomID, userID, "join", "invite")
- }
- func (s *SQLStateStore) IsMembership(roomID id.RoomID, userID id.UserID, allowedMemberships ...event.Membership) bool {
- membership := s.GetMembership(roomID, userID)
- for _, allowedMembership := range allowedMemberships {
- if allowedMembership == membership {
- return true
- }
- }
- return false
- }
- func (s *SQLStateStore) GetMembership(roomID id.RoomID, userID id.UserID) event.Membership {
- query := "SELECT membership FROM mx_user_profile WHERE " +
- "room_id=$1 AND user_id=$2"
- row := s.db.QueryRow(query, roomID, userID)
- membership := event.MembershipLeave
- err := row.Scan(&membership)
- if err != nil && err != sql.ErrNoRows {
- s.log.Warnfln("Failed to scan membership of %s in %s: %v", userID, roomID, err)
- }
- return membership
- }
- func (s *SQLStateStore) GetMember(roomID id.RoomID, userID id.UserID) *event.MemberEventContent {
- member, ok := s.TryGetMember(roomID, userID)
- if !ok {
- member.Membership = event.MembershipLeave
- }
- return member
- }
- func (s *SQLStateStore) TryGetMember(roomID id.RoomID, userID id.UserID) (*event.MemberEventContent, bool) {
- query := "SELECT membership, displayname, avatar_url FROM mx_user_profile " +
- "WHERE room_id=$1 AND user_id=$2"
- row := s.db.QueryRow(query, roomID, userID)
- var member event.MemberEventContent
- err := row.Scan(&member.Membership, &member.Displayname, &member.AvatarURL)
- if err != nil && err != sql.ErrNoRows {
- s.log.Warnfln("Failed to scan member info of %s in %s: %v", userID, roomID, err)
- }
- return &member, err == nil
- }
- func (s *SQLStateStore) SetMembership(roomID id.RoomID, userID id.UserID, membership event.Membership) {
- query := "INSERT INTO mx_user_profile (room_id, user_id, membership)" +
- " VALUES ($1, $2, $3) ON CONFLICT (room_id, user_id) DO UPDATE SET" +
- " membership=excluded.membership"
- _, err := s.db.Exec(query, roomID, userID, membership)
- if err != nil {
- s.log.Warnfln("Failed to set membership of %s in %s to %s: %v", userID, roomID, membership, err)
- }
- }
- func (s *SQLStateStore) SetMember(roomID id.RoomID, userID id.UserID, member *event.MemberEventContent) {
- query := "INSERT INTO mx_user_profile" +
- " (room_id, user_id, membership, displayname, avatar_url)" +
- " VALUES ($1, $2, $3, $4, $5) ON CONFLICT (room_id, user_id)" +
- " DO UPDATE SET membership=excluded.membership," +
- " displayname=excluded.displayname, avatar_url=excluded.avatar_url"
- _, err := s.db.Exec(query, roomID, userID, member.Membership, member.Displayname, member.AvatarURL)
- if err != nil {
- s.log.Warnfln("Failed to set membership of %s in %s to %s: %v", userID, roomID, member, err)
- }
- }
- func (s *SQLStateStore) SetPowerLevels(roomID id.RoomID, levels *event.PowerLevelsEventContent) {
- levelsBytes, err := json.Marshal(levels)
- if err != nil {
- s.log.Errorfln("Failed to marshal power levels of %s: %v", roomID, err)
- return
- }
- query := "INSERT INTO mx_room_state (room_id, power_levels)" +
- " VALUES ($1, $2) ON CONFLICT (room_id) DO UPDATE SET" +
- " power_levels=excluded.power_levels"
- _, err = s.db.Exec(query, roomID, levelsBytes)
- if err != nil {
- s.log.Warnfln("Failed to store power levels of %s: %v", roomID, err)
- }
- }
- func (s *SQLStateStore) GetPowerLevels(roomID id.RoomID) *event.PowerLevelsEventContent {
- query := "SELECT power_levels FROM mx_room_state WHERE room_id=$1"
- row := s.db.QueryRow(query, roomID)
- if row == nil {
- return nil
- }
- var data []byte
- err := row.Scan(&data)
- if err != nil {
- s.log.Errorfln("Failed to scan power levels of %s: %v", roomID, err)
- return nil
- }
- levels := &event.PowerLevelsEventContent{}
- err = json.Unmarshal(data, levels)
- if err != nil {
- s.log.Errorfln("Failed to parse power levels of %s: %v", roomID, err)
- return nil
- }
- return levels
- }
- func (s *SQLStateStore) GetPowerLevel(roomID id.RoomID, userID id.UserID) int {
- if s.db.dialect == "postgres" {
- query := "SELECT COALESCE((power_levels->'users'->$2)::int," +
- " (power_levels->'users_default')::int, 0)" +
- " FROM mx_room_state WHERE room_id=$1"
- row := s.db.QueryRow(query, roomID, userID)
- if row == nil {
- // Power levels not in db
- return 0
- }
- var powerLevel int
- err := row.Scan(&powerLevel)
- if err != nil {
- s.log.Errorfln("Failed to scan power level of %s in %s: %v", userID, roomID, err)
- }
- return powerLevel
- }
- return s.GetPowerLevels(roomID).GetUserLevel(userID)
- }
- func (s *SQLStateStore) GetPowerLevelRequirement(roomID id.RoomID, eventType event.Type) int {
- if s.db.dialect == "postgres" {
- defaultType := "events_default"
- defaultValue := 0
- if eventType.IsState() {
- defaultType = "state_default"
- defaultValue = 50
- }
- query := "SELECT COALESCE((power_levels->'events'->$2)::int," +
- " (power_levels->'$3')::int, $4)" +
- " FROM mx_room_state WHERE room_id=$1"
- row := s.db.QueryRow(query, roomID, eventType.Type, defaultType, defaultValue)
- if row == nil {
- // Power levels not in db
- return defaultValue
- }
- var powerLevel int
- err := row.Scan(&powerLevel)
- if err != nil {
- s.log.Errorfln("Failed to scan power level for %s in %s: %v", eventType, roomID, err)
- }
- return powerLevel
- }
- return s.GetPowerLevels(roomID).GetEventLevel(eventType)
- }
- func (s *SQLStateStore) HasPowerLevel(roomID id.RoomID, userID id.UserID, eventType event.Type) bool {
- if s.db.dialect == "postgres" {
- defaultType := "events_default"
- defaultValue := 0
- if eventType.IsState() {
- defaultType = "state_default"
- defaultValue = 50
- }
- query := "SELECT COALESCE((power_levels->'users'->$2)::int," +
- " (power_levels->'users_default')::int, 0) >=" +
- " COALESCE((power_levels->'events'->$3)::int," +
- " (power_levels->'$4')::int, $5)" +
- " FROM mx_room_state WHERE room_id=$1"
- row := s.db.QueryRow(query, roomID, userID, eventType.Type, defaultType, defaultValue)
- if row == nil {
- // Power levels not in db
- return defaultValue == 0
- }
- var hasPower bool
- err := row.Scan(&hasPower)
- if err != nil {
- s.log.Errorfln("Failed to scan power level for %s in %s: %v", eventType, roomID, err)
- }
- return hasPower
- }
- return s.GetPowerLevel(roomID, userID) >= s.GetPowerLevelRequirement(roomID, eventType)
- }
- func (store *SQLStateStore) FindSharedRooms(userID id.UserID) []id.RoomID {
- query := `
- SELECT room_id FROM mx_user_profile
- LEFT JOIN portal ON portal.mxid=mx_user_profile.room_id
- WHERE user_id=$1 AND portal.encrypted=true
- `
- rooms := []id.RoomID{}
- rows, err := store.db.Query(query, userID)
- if err != nil {
- store.log.Warnfln("Failed to query shared rooms with %s: %v", userID, err)
- return rooms
- }
- for rows.Next() {
- var roomID id.RoomID
- err = rows.Scan(&roomID)
- if err != nil {
- store.log.Warnfln("Failed to scan room ID: %v", err)
- } else {
- rooms = append(rooms, roomID)
- }
- }
- return rooms
- }
